Analyzing definition

Analyzing a definition involves examining its components, clarifying its meaning, and evaluating its accuracy and effectiveness in conveying the intended concept or idea.

To analyze a definition, one would typically:

1. Identify the key terms or words in the definition and understand their significance.
2. Break down complex or ambiguous terms into simpler, more precise terms.
3. Consider the context in which the definition is used and ascertain the intended meaning or concept being defined.
4. Assess the clarity and accuracy of the definition by checking for vagueness, ambiguity, or circular reasoning.
5. Compare the definition to other existing definitions of the same concept or idea.
6. Evaluate the effectiveness of the definition in capturing the essence of the concept or idea and conveying it accurately to the audience or reader.

The purpose of analyzing a definition is to gain a deeper understanding of the concept being defined, ensure clarity and precision in communication, and enhance critical thinking skills by examining the validity and soundness of the definition.
